I. The Basic Conversion: 400mm to Feet

Q: How many feet are there in 400 millimeters?

A: There are approximately 1.312 feet in 400 millimeters. This is derived from the fundamental conversion factor: 1 inch = 25.4 millimeters. Therefore, to convert millimeters to feet, we follow these steps:

1. Millimeters to Inches: Divide the millimeters by 25.4 (400 mm / 25.4 mm/inch ≈ 15.75 inches).
2. Inches to Feet: Divide the inches by 12 (15.75 inches / 12 inches/foot ≈ 1.312 feet).

Therefore, 400 millimeters is roughly equivalent to 1.312 feet. It’s crucial to remember that this is an approximation due to rounding. For extremely precise applications, more decimal places should be retained throughout the calculation.

III. Understanding Measurement Precision and Rounding

Q: How accurate is the 1.312 feet approximation? Should I always round to the nearest tenth or hundredth of a foot?

A: The accuracy depends on the context. For many purposes, rounding to 1.31 feet is sufficient. However, in situations requiring high precision, such as engineering or machining, retaining more decimal places is essential. The level of precision required dictates the appropriate rounding. For example, in carpentry, rounding to the nearest 1/16th of an inch might be more practical than expressing the answer in feet with many decimal places.

Consider the following:

Low Precision: General estimations, quick calculations, and non-critical measurements may tolerate rounding to the nearest tenth or even whole number.
High Precision: Engineering, machining, and scientific applications necessitate higher precision and may require retaining several decimal places or even using fractions of an inch for greater accuracy.

FAQs:

1. Q: Can I convert directly from millimeters to feet without going through inches? A: Yes, you can use a single conversion factor: 1 foot = 304.8 millimeters. Divide 400mm by 304.8mm/ft to get the result directly.

2. Q: What if I need to convert a different number of millimeters to feet? A: Use the same conversion factors (1 inch = 25.4 mm and 1 foot = 12 inches) and apply the same steps. Simply replace 400 mm with your desired value.

3. Q: Are there any common errors to avoid when converting? A: The most common error is using the wrong conversion factor or misplacing the decimal point during calculation. Double-checking your work and using online calculators can help mitigate these errors.
